Practical Materials Engineering on Industrial Artefacts

FSI-0MIAcad. year: 2023/2024

The seminar offers an insight in practical materials engineering. By hands-on experience, the students learn how to apply basic principles of material science on the results they can see on samples prepared by classical materials engineering approaches.

Entry knowledge

Knowledge of material science, mathematics, chemistry and physics on the first year level is expected.

Rules for evaluation and completion of the course

The results will be publicly presented. Based on the presentation , credits are awarded.
Since this is an electorial course, the activities in this course are assessed on the basis of the student's own results obtained in the lab, and the quality of the final presentation.

Aims

The objective is to introduce second year students to practical use of materials engineering methods. Students have hands on experience with laboratory equipment and can find the principles that are lectured in theory having real effect.
Practical experience with material engineering analysis methods.
